Order Michigan Supreme Court Lansing, Michigan November 6, 2013 Robert P. Young, Jr., Chief Justice Michael F. Cavanagh Stephen J. Markman 146824(85) Mary Beth Kelly Brian K. Zahra Bridget M. McCormack David F. Viviano, Justices

PEOPLE OF THE STATE OF MICHIGAN, Plaintiff-Appellee, SC: 146824 v COA: 302132 Wayne CC: 06-008265-FH CARL JESSE HOUGH, Defendant-Appellant. ______________________________/ On order of the Chief Justice, the motion of plaintiff-appellee to extend the time for filing an answer to defendant-appellant’s application for leave to appeal is GRANTED. The answer will be accepted as timely filed if it is filed on or before January 8, 2014.
